Update hacking and fix hacking violations

This does a few things:

* Update hacking to the version in global-requirements. Old hacking was
  installing a version of pbr that was breaking other packages.

* Fix all the hacking/pep8 rules that updating hacking raised.

* Do some general docstring cleanup, while already in there cleaning up
  a bunch of docstrings due to H405 violations.
